🕒 <a name="session-structure"></a>Session Structure Templates
Use structured blocks for predictable pacing, professionalism, and scalability.
🟩 30-Minute Session Example
-
Warm-Up: 5 mins
-
Main Block (HIIT/EMOM/Strength + Conditioning): 15–20 mins
-
Stretch + Announcements: 4 mins
-
Total: ~29 mins
🟨 45-Minute Session Example
-
Warm-Up: 8–10 mins
-
Strength: 12 mins
-
Conditioning: 12 mins
-
Stretch & Announcements: 4 mins
-
Buffer: 7–9 mins (water breaks, resets, announcements)
🟥 60-Minute Session Example (5-Part Model)
-
Warm-Up: 10 mins
-
Power: 10 mins
-
Strength: 10 mins
-
Conditioning: 10 mins
-
Stretch/Announcements: 4 mins
-
Built-In Extras: 8–12 mins (water, demos, transitions)
✅ <a name="coach-checklist"></a>Coach Execution Checklist
Before Class Starts:
-
Floor is clean and fully set up
-
Coach arrives early (15+ mins)
-
Music is ready (clean, curated, fresh playlist)
-
Bathrooms are clean and stocked
As Members Arrive:
-
Greet by name within 10 seconds
-
Check-in system updated
-
Encourage social media check-ins
-
Introduce new members to OGs
During Class:
-
Use two volume levels (lower for demos, higher for work)
-
Demonstrate and explain every movement
-
Don’t overload—only 2–4 exercises at a time
-
Give every member 2+ coaching cues
-
Shout out every member at least twice
-
Use automated timers and wall clocks
-
Smile, high-five, and make it fun

🧘 <a name="post-workout"></a>Post-Workout Strategy
At the end of every session:
-
Cooldown & Stretch (3–4 mins)
-
Reset the Room: Members reset stations for the next class.
-
Group Huddle/Hands-In: Celebrate effort and community.
-
Announcements & Referrals:
-
Shout out referrals and new clients
-
Highlight upcoming internal promotions/events
-
Encourage goal tracking and retention programs

📝 <a name="rubric"></a>Coaching Rubric & Session Review
Use binary grading (yes/no) to evaluate coaching performance.
Sample Grading Areas:
| Category | Criteria | Y/N |
|---|---|---|
| Floor Readiness | Was the room fully set up? | ✅/❌ |
| Member Greeting | Did the coach greet all members by name? | ✅/❌ |
| Start Time | Did the session begin on time? | ✅/❌ |
| Volume | Was warm-up music at level 5? | ✅/❌ |
| Coaching | Did they demonstrate all exercises? | ✅/❌ |
| Engagement | Did the coach give each member feedback? | ✅/❌ |
| Energy | Was the session high energy and engaging? | ✅/❌ |
| Cleanup | Was the room reset post-session? | ✅/❌ |
| Referrals | Were announcements and shout-outs made? | ✅/❌ |
Include a notes section for detailed feedback.
📅 Review Frequency:
-
New coaches: Monthly
-
Experienced coaches: Quarterly or bi-annually
Use this data for:
-
Reviews
-
Promotions
-
Pay raises
-
Continuing education plans
